# ๐Ÿ† Winning Wallet Finder Find Polymarket wallets with a **real, statistically-verifiable edge**, test whether copying them actually makes money, and **get pinged the moment they trade**. This started as "copy the smart money." Along the way we tested โ€” and ruled out โ€” six systematic public-data strategies, and found that the *only* signal that holds up is **statistical improbability**: wallets that win far more than the prices they paid imply. This repo is the tooling for finding and watching those wallets, plus an honest record of everything that didn't work. > **Read [`FINDINGS.md`](FINDINGS.md) for the full story.** TL;DR: detection of > edge wallets works; *profitably copying them* is unproven (it survived a naive > backtest but collapsed to one-wallet variance out-of-sample). Treat this as a > research + monitoring tool, not a money printer. --- ## The core idea: z-score, not win rate Every Polymarket bet has an entry price that *is* the market's estimate of its odds (a YES at 30ยข โ‡’ market thinks 30%). If you have no edge, over many bets you win about the **sum of your entry prices** โ€” call it *expected wins*. ``` z = (actual wins โˆ’ expected wins) / standard deviation ``` - **z = 0** โ†’ you won exactly what your prices implied โ†’ no edge. - **z = 3** โ†’ ~1-in-740 by luck. **z = 5** โ†’ ~1-in-3.5M. **z = 9** โ†’ astronomical. - **`p(luck)`** is z as a probability: the chance a no-edge bettor does this well by chance. Why this beats win rate: a wallet that bets longshots and **wins 14% when the odds implied 8%** has a huge edge (high z) despite a low win rate. A wallet buying 90ยข favorites and winning 90% has zโ‰ˆ0 โ€” no edge, just paying for favorites. **z measures beating the prices you paid.** Two refinements separate signal from noise: - **Lifetime trade count** โ€” high z + tens of thousands of trades = a market-maker bot, not an insider. Real edge wallets have *concentrated* edge over a few thousand trades. - **Pre-resolution timing + fresh wallet** โ€” entering minutes/hours before resolution on a new account is the insider fingerprint (the Bubblemaps / *60 Minutes* pattern). --- ## How the pieces fit ``` data layer detection hunting validation live โ”€โ”€โ”€โ”€โ”€โ”€โ”€โ”€โ”€โ”€ โ”€โ”€โ”€โ”€โ”€โ”€โ”€โ”€โ”€ โ”€โ”€โ”€โ”€โ”€โ”€โ”€ โ”€โ”€โ”€โ”€โ”€โ”€โ”€โ”€โ”€โ”€ โ”€โ”€โ”€โ”€ smart_money.py โ”€โ”€โ–ถ insider.py โ”€โ”€โ–ถ hunt.py / huntwide.py โ”€โ–ถ copyback.py / oos.py webhook_receiver.py (Polymarket API, (z-score, timing, (sweep markets, (does copying them (Alchemy webhook โ†’ true win rate) freshness, funding surface edge wallets) actually pay? in- & Discord ping on clustering) out-of-sample) every trade) ``` | File | Role | |------|------| | `insider.py` | **The detector.** z-score/p-value, pre-resolution timing, fresh-wallet & sizing flags, and Alchemy funding-cluster ring detection. `--scan` / `--market` / `--wallet`. | | `smart_money.py` | Data foundation + dashboard. Keep the two wallet lists in sync: Alchemy's address list (what *triggers*) and `watch.json` (what *names* the alert). --- ## The honest verdict - **Detection works.** z-score + timing + funding-cluster reliably surfaces statistically anomalous wallets (the 60-Minutes use case). - **Copying them is not proven.** In-sample a weighted, compounding copy returned +545%; out-of-sample (select pre-May, copy forward) it was +168% โ€” but driven entirely by *one* longshot lottery wallet, with the strongest signals contributing nothing. That's variance, not a durable, fundable edge. - **No turnkey public-data edge survived** โ€” copy-trading, win-rate ranking, LP reward farming, binary/multi-outcome arb, and cross-venue arb all came back efficient or illusory. See [`FINDINGS.md`](FINDINGS.md). Use this to **find and watch** edge wallets and gather forward data โ€” not as a green light to bet size on copying them.
